Barca make formal Fabregas offer

Barcelona have confirmed they have submitted a written offer to Arsenal for midfielder Cesc Fabregas and are now in "formal" discussions.

The 23-year-old has long been linked with a return to Barca, the club where he plied his trade as a youngster before moving to the Gunners seven years ago.

And Barca director general Joan Oliver told club website www.fcbarcelona.cat on Wednesday: "Everyone knows that Cesc wants to play for this club and everyone knows that we also want this. But there is a third major player, which is Arsenal. Any deal must go through them and June 1 was the beginning of the period of official negotiations."

He added: "Until earlier there were informal conversations, but since yesterday (Tuesday) these are formal - and the usual mechanism is to present a formal and concrete offer.

"So yesterday afternoon, we submitted a written bid to Arsenal."

Fabregas is under contract with the north London outfit until June 2014 but last month expressed his desire to head back to the Nou Camp at a promotional event in the Catalan capital.

That wish could have moved a step closer to reality over the past two days.
